Specifications
Autofocus (during viewfinder shooting)
Type: TTL secondary image-registration, phase-difference
detection with the dedicated AF sensor
AF points: Max. 45 points (Cross-type AF point: Max. 45 points)
* Number of available AF points, Dual cross-type AF
points, and Cross-type AF points vary depending on
the lens used.
* Dual cross-type focusing at f/2.8 with center AF point
when Group A (of the AF groups) lenses are used.
Focusing brightness
range:
EV -3 - 18 (with the center AF point supporting f/2.8,
One-Shot AF, room temperature, ISO 100)
Focus operation: One-Shot AF, AI Servo AF, AI Focus AF, Manual focusing
(MF)
AF area selection mode: Single-point Spot AF (manual selection), Single-point AF
(manual selection), Zone AF (manual selection of zone),
Large zone AF (manual selection of zone), Automatic
selection AF
AF point automatic
selection conditions:
Automatic AF point selection possible based on color
information equivalent to human skin-tone
AI Servo AF
characteristics:
Characteristics can be set with Custom Functions for
Tracking sensitivity, Acceleration/deceleration tracking,
and AF point auto switching
AF fine adjustment: AF Microadjustment (All lenses by the same amount,
Adjust by lens)
AF-assist beam: With the EOS-dedicated external Speedlite
Exposure Control
Metering mode: Approx. 7,560-pixel RGB+IR metering sensor and
63-zone TTL open-aperture metering
• Evaluative metering (linked to all AF points)
• Partial metering (approx. 6.5% of viewfinder at center)
• Spot metering (approx. 3.2% of viewfinder at center)
• Center-weighted average metering
Metering brightness
range:
EV 1 - 20 (at room temperature, ISO 100)
